HSE Advisor - Gas Industry

Salary: £45,000 - £55,000 per annum (dependent on experience) + benefits

Location: Speke, Liverpool (Hybrid working with regular travel to operational sites)

Type: Permanent

HRGO Recruitment is recruiting on behalf of a leading organisation within the utilities and infrastructure sector for an experienced HSE Advisor.

This is an excellent opportunity for a health and safety professional with experience in gas, utilities or infrastructure environments to support the safe delivery of operational projects. You will work closely with operational teams, project managers and contractors, providing practical HSE guidance, ensuring compliance and promoting a strong safety culture.

The role:

Supporting teams with day to day HSE guidance, ensuring safe working practices are embedded throughout projects.
Reviewing and developing key safety documentation including RAMS, Construction Phase Plans and Traffic Management Plans.
Providing assurance through site visits, inspections and audits, identifying risks and helping teams implement effective solutions.
Advising project teams and contractors on legal requirements, company standards and best practice.
Supporting investigations into incidents, near misses and safety concerns, helping to identify improvements and prevent recurrence.
Assisting with risk assessment activities, including HAZID, HAZOP and hazardous area reviews.
Delivering safety briefings, toolbox talks and engagement activities to encourage positive safety behaviours.
Maintaining accurate HSE records and supporting internal, client and external compliance reviews.
Contributing to the continual improvement of HSE processes, procedures and systems.The candidate:

You will have previous experience as an HSE Advisor within the gas, utilities, civil engineering or infrastructure sectors, with:

Strong knowledge of UK health and safety legislation, including CDM Regulations 2015, PUWER, LOLER and Working at Height Regulations.
Experience producing RAMS, CPPs and Traffic Management Plans.
Experience conducting site inspections and audits.
Knowledge of HAZID, HAZOP and risk management processes.
Excellent communication, report writing and stakeholder management skills.
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
Full UK driving licence.Qualifications

Ideally, you will hold:

NEBOSH General Certificate (essential).
NEBOSH Construction Certificate (desirable).
IOSH Membership (TechIOSH/GradIOSH) or working towards CMIOSH.
